WhatsApp employs End-to-End Encryption (E2EE) utilizing the Signal Protocol. This implies that messages are encrypted on the sender's gadget and can only be decrypted by the intended recipient's device. Not even Meta (the parent business) can read the messages in transit.

To bypass this, a "hacker" would essentially require to:
Compromise the physical gadget: Using malware or Pegasus-style spyware.Exploit the backup system: Accessing unencrypted backups on Google Drive or iCloud (if the user hasn't allowed encrypted backups).Social Engineering: Tricking the user into sharing their 6-digit registration code or scanning a WhatsApp Web QR code.The Legal and Ethical Landscape

Necessary Security Checklist:
Enable Two-Step Verification: This adds a PIN that must be gotten in when resetting or validating the account.Disable Cloud Backups (or Encrypt Them): If backups are not secured, they are the most common entry point for trespassers.Review Linked Devices: Regularly examine "Linked Devices" in settings to guarantee no unapproved computers are logged into your WhatsApp Web.Usage Biometric Locks: Enable Fingerprint or FaceID locks for the app itself within the personal privacy settings.Alternatives to "Hacking"
